The Future for Young Activists in the LGBTQI Movement

Join us this week for the next installment of the Out in Reel Film Series! On Wednesday, April 18 in Hoyt Hall Auditorium we’ll be screening a short documentary and discussing the changing nature of the LGBTQ movement and what the future holds for young activists. A panel of students, activists, and community leaders will share their insight. The panel is organized by Pride Network, the undergraduate LGBTQ and Allies group at the University of Rochester.

The panel includes:
Andrew Moran, SafeZone Coordinator, University of Rochester
Christopher Henry Hinesly, past Executive Director, Gay Alliance of the Genesee Valley
Alex Montes, current University of Rochester student
Jim Costich, Speakers Bureau, Gay Alliance of the Genesee Valley
